Harrison County, MS - 2026 Building Permit Guide
How to apply for a building permit in unincorporated Harrison County, Mississippi. Permit authority, application steps, fees, and inspection requirements.
Permit Authority
Covers all unincorporated areas of Harrison County only. Incorporated cities (Biloxi, D'Iberville, Gulfport, Long Beach, Pass Christian) maintain their own permit authorities.

Application Process
- Confirm the project is not in a Special Flood Hazard Area (SFHA); if in SFHA, submit in person with all required documents.
- Obtain zoning approval from the Zoning Administrator (Patrick Bonck, 228-831-3367) for intended use and setbacks before applying.
- Complete the online permit application with a valid email address. Select all applicable work descriptions.
- A SUCCESS confirmation is displayed and a PIN is sent to the provided email address.
- Log back in using the email and PIN, then upload all required documents. Application is not forwarded to staff until all documents are uploaded.
- County departments (Zoning, Engineering, Code Administration) may request additional information.
- For projects with new septic systems, obtain a Soil Evaluation Certificate (Form 335) from the Harrison County Health Department (1-855-220-0192) and submit it with the application.
- Install culvert/proper property access before final inspection.
- Permit is issued; construction begins.
- Complete final inspection. If a new septic system is involved, obtain the final Health Department certificate (Form 910) before power is connected to the utility.

General Requirements
Required for all construction, alterations, repairs, and demolition in unincorporated Harrison County.
Required Documents
- Completed building permit application
- Set of plans for the dwelling (including structural, floor plan, elevations)
- Plot plan showing building on property with setbacks from front, sides, and rear lines
- Copy of deed, tax receipt, or signed purchase contract
- Soil Evaluation Certificate (Form 335) if new septic tank or sewer treatment plant is being installed
- Value of work estimate
- For properties in a SFHA: additional flood elevation documentation required; must apply in person
- For solar panels: structural design analysis, wind/seismic design analysis, panel layout with clearances, electrical layout and schematic
- For mobile homes: mobile home registration certificate, plot plan, health department forms if septic is involved

- Building code
- International Building Code (IBC) 2018
- Owner-builder
- Not published; contact Code Administration.
- Contractor requirements
- The county issues licenses for electricians, plumbers, and mechanical contractors through the Code Administration office.
Fees
- Permit fee formula
- Not published online. Known flat fees: Mobile home on private property $50; mobile home in mobile home park $25.

Inspections
How to Schedule
- 228-832-1622 (phone)
- Inspection hours
- Monday-Friday, 8:00 AM to 5:00 PM
Typical inspection sequence: Typical sequence: (1) Foundation/footing; (2) framing/rough-in; (3) final. For mobile homes: culvert must be installed before inspection. For septic systems: a final Health Department certificate (Form 910) is required before power is connected.

- What work is exempt from building permits in unincorporated Harrison County, MS?
- The following work is generally exempt: Farm buildings and farm structures (exempt by state law, except as required by the Flood Disaster Protection Act of 1973); Purely cosmetic work: painting, flooring, cabinet replacement, and minor repairs that do not affect structural, electrical, mechanical, or plumbing systems. Note: Always confirm specific exemptions with Code Administration at 228-832-1622, as the county does not publish a detailed exempt work list on its website.
